do you have to have a phoneline to get broadband

slickric1234
Posts: 358 Forumite
moving to a new house...
virgin (who i was with) not available
think bt phoneline is plumbed into the road as opposed to overhead
sky is available (guy next door has a dish)
i want broadband and sky tv (sports) not bothered about hd
so variety pack and skysports is £36 per month from sky + £49 for the box
when i go to phoneline i click that i dont have one and the broadband (which is advertised as free) dissappears
says you have to pay them £11 a month for a sky phoneline then set up broadband after its installed
dont want nor need a home phone as i have a crazy number of free minutes on my mobile that i never even get close to using
after adding the phoneline and paying the £39 install fee am i correct in thinking that the broadband options will be free / £5 /£10 unlimited use
are there any cheaper ways of getting broadband as with unlimited it will effectively be costing me £21 a month for the unlimited broadband
with a £39 install fee for something i dont want nor need

you need to have a landline to get broadband
Depends if you call a 3g data connection "broadband" or not. I've got a 3g dongle which is advertised as "mobile broadband" but the performance is not so good as I only get 1.5mb/s instead of 13mb/s wired and ping times are dire at bout 150ms vs 12ms wired.0 -
